79964ac8 | 1 | /** @file\r |
444bf90d | 2 | Definition of GUIDed HOB for reserving SMRAM regions.\r |
3 | \r | |
4 | This file defines:\r | |
5 | * the GUID used to identify the GUID HOB for reserving SMRAM regions.\r | |
6 | * the data structure of SMRAM descriptor to describe SMRAM candidate regions\r | |
7 | * values of state of SMRAM candidate regions\r | |
8 | * the GUID specific data structure of HOB for reserving SMRAM regions.\r | |
9 | This GUIDed HOB can be used to convey the existence of the T-SEG reservation and H-SEG usage\r | |

444bf90d | 35 | ///\r |
36 | /// Describes the candidate regions for SMRAM that are\r | |
37 | /// supported by this platform.\r | |
38 | ///\r | |
79964ac8 | 39 | typedef struct {\r |
444bf90d | 40 | EFI_PHYSICAL_ADDRESS PhysicalStart; ///< Designates the physical address of the SMRAM in memory.\r |
41 | EFI_PHYSICAL_ADDRESS CpuStart; ///< Designates the address of the SMRAM, as seen by software executing on the processors. \r | |
42 | UINT64 PhysicalSize; ///< Describes the number of bytes in the SMRAM region.\r | |
43 | UINT64 RegionState; ///< Describes the accessibility attributes of the SMRAM.\r | |
79964ac8 | 44 | } EFI_SMRAM_DESCRIPTOR;\r |
45 | \r | |
46 | //\r | |
444bf90d | 47 | // Definition of SMRAM states, used as value for EFI_SMRAM_DESCRIPTOR.RegionState.\r |
79964ac8 | 48 | //\r |
49 | #define EFI_SMRAM_OPEN 0x00000001\r | |
50 | #define EFI_SMRAM_CLOSED 0x00000002\r | |
51 | #define EFI_SMRAM_LOCKED 0x00000004\r | |
52 | #define EFI_CACHEABLE 0x00000008\r | |
53 | #define EFI_ALLOCATED 0x00000010\r | |
